T H (Taa Haa)
In the Name of God, the Merciful, the Compassionate
۞ O MAN! 1 We have not sent down the Qur'an to you that you should be burdened, 2 Except as a reminder for one who fears. 3 a revelation from Him who has created the earth and the high heavens 4 The Compassionate on the Throne is established. 5 To Him belongs all that is in the heavens and the earth, and all that lies between them, and underneath the soil. 6 And if you speak aloud – so He surely knows the secret and that which is more concealed. 7 Allah - there is no god but He. His are the most excellent names. 8 Have you heard the story of Moses? 9 When he saw a fire and said unto his folk: Lo! Wait! I see a fire afar off. Peradventure I may bring you a brand therefrom or may find guidance at the fire. 10 But when he came close to it, a voice called out: "O Moses! 11 "Verily! I am your Lord! So take off your shoes, you are in the sacred valley, Tuwa. 12 I have chosen you. Therefore, listen to what shall be revealed. 13 I Am the only God. Worship Me and be steadfast in prayer to have My name always in your mind. 14 "Verily, the Hour is coming and My Will is to keep it hidden that every person may be rewarded for that which he strives. 15 Therefor, let not him turn thee aside from (the thought of) it who believeth not therein but followeth his own desire, lest thou perish. 16 "Now, what is this in thy right hand, O Moses?" 17 He replied, "It is my staff. I lean on it, and with it, I beat down the leaves for my flock; I also have other uses for it." 18 The Lord said, "Moses, throw it on the ground". 19 and he cast it down, and behold it was a serpent sliding. 20 (Allah) said, "Seize it, and fear not: We shall return it at once to its former condition".. 21 "Now place thy hand within thy armpit: it will come forth [shining] white, without blemish, as another sign [of Our grace,] 22 for We shall show you some of Our greatest Signs. 23 Go to Pharaoh; he has waxed insolent.' 24
